Village Overview

Badora is a village in Betul Tehsil, also recorded as a Census sub-district, Betul district, Madhya Pradesh. For Badora, the population is 5,671 and Census village code is 485618. Location and Administration

Badora comes under Badora gram panchayat and Betul C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Betul Tehsil,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The tehsil headquarters is Betul at 4 km. The Census district headquarters, Betul, is 4 km away.

Agriculture and Land Use

Land-use area is reported in hectares using Census village directory land-use categories such as net area sown, irrigated area, forest, fallow land and non-agricultural use. This is useful for general village research, farming context and local area study.

Agriculture and land-use records for Badora
Net area sown485.45 hectares
Irrigated area448.30 hectares
Unirrigated area37.15 hectares
Wells / tube wells irrigated area248.30 hectares
Tanks / lakes irrigated area200 hectares
Non-agricultural area53.10 hectares
Other fallow land61.91 hectares
Main cropSoybean
Second cropSugarcane
Third cropWheat
